An important message to our valued customers about PEDIGREE. Dry dog
food and WHISKAS. Dry cat food:

The makers of PEDIGREE. and WHISKAS. are committed to quality. We
will do whatever it takes to protect the health and safety of our
customers' pets.

Therefore, on Thursday, 11 March, we announced our decision to 
expand our voluntary recall of PEDIGREE. Dry dog food and recall WHISKAS.
Dry cat food in Southeast Asia, Korea and Japan because of concerns
over raw material quality at a manufacturing plant in Thailand.

The company's investigation has not confirmed a direct link between
this finding and a previously reported increase in renal disease
among dogs in Taiwan, Thailand and the Philippines. Veterinarians
have not reported such problems with cats. Therefore, thi s is a
precaution.

The recall applies to PEDIGREE. Dry dog food, WHISKAS. Dry cat food
and PEDIGREE. Dog's Delight Ringo, PEDIGREE. Dog's Delight Tasty 
Bone and PEDIGREE. Puppy Biscuit dog treats manufactured at the Thailand
plant. The products were sold in Taiwan, Korea, Indonesia, Malaysia,
the Philippines, Thailand, Singapore and Vietnam. KITEKAT. dry sold
in Thailand and Malaysia as well as CESAR. Duo sold in Taiwan and
Korea are also to be withdrawn.
